diff options
author | unknown <sasha@mysql.sashanet.com> | 2001-08-09 19:16:15 -0600 |
---|---|---|
committer | unknown <sasha@mysql.sashanet.com> | 2001-08-09 19:16:15 -0600 |
commit | 9a6a7bf5f694dae0b33e61301a17f7aa6fcd1b62 (patch) | |
tree | ed06f905f1515a2117cc0c243c526264fccaac77 /innobase/include/srv0srv.h | |
parent | 4bb40187438bdfb8b1d8b091399bd01e0e3425c1 (diff) | |
parent | ebb3bd0f75ecb2b89e4fe07c693caa9e09c2ce3a (diff) | |
download | mariadb-git-9a6a7bf5f694dae0b33e61301a17f7aa6fcd1b62.tar.gz |
merged
BitKeeper/etc/logging_ok:
auto-union
BitKeeper/etc/ignore:
auto-union
Makefile.am:
Auto merged
ltmain.sh:
Auto merged
libmysql/Makefile.shared:
Auto merged
libmysql/libmysql.c:
Auto merged
myisam/myisamchk.c:
Auto merged
mysql-test/t/bdb.test:
Auto merged
sql/ha_myisam.cc:
Auto merged
sql/item_func.cc:
Auto merged
sql/sql_parse.cc:
Auto merged
sql/sql_yacc.yy:
Auto merged
sql/sql_class.cc:
Auto merged
sql/sql_class.h:
Auto merged
sql/sql_lex.cc:
Auto merged
sql/sql_select.cc:
Auto merged
Diffstat (limited to 'innobase/include/srv0srv.h')
-rw-r--r-- | innobase/include/srv0srv.h | 22 |
1 files changed, 8 insertions, 14 deletions
diff --git a/innobase/include/srv0srv.h b/innobase/include/srv0srv.h index f80abda19c6..e635964e5ec 100644 --- a/innobase/include/srv0srv.h +++ b/innobase/include/srv0srv.h @@ -27,6 +27,9 @@ extern char** srv_data_file_names; extern ulint* srv_data_file_sizes; extern ulint* srv_data_file_is_raw_partition; +#define SRV_NEW_RAW 1 +#define SRV_OLD_RAW 2 + extern char** srv_log_group_home_dirs; extern ulint srv_n_log_groups; @@ -52,10 +55,14 @@ extern ulint srv_lock_wait_timeout; extern char* srv_unix_file_flush_method_str; extern ulint srv_unix_file_flush_method; +extern ibool srv_use_doublewrite_buf; + extern ibool srv_set_thread_priorities; extern int srv_query_thread_priority; /*-------------------------------------------*/ + +extern ibool srv_print_innodb_monitor; extern ulint srv_n_spin_wait_rounds; extern ulint srv_spin_wait_delay; extern ibool srv_priority_boost; @@ -104,26 +111,13 @@ typedef struct srv_sys_struct srv_sys_t; /* The server system */ extern srv_sys_t* srv_sys; -/* Alternatives for file flush option in Unix; see the InnoDB manual about +/* Alternatives for fiel flush option in Unix; see the InnoDB manual about what these mean */ #define SRV_UNIX_FDATASYNC 1 #define SRV_UNIX_O_DSYNC 2 #define SRV_UNIX_LITTLESYNC 3 #define SRV_UNIX_NOSYNC 4 -/* Raw partition flags */ -#define SRV_OLD_RAW 1 -#define SRV_NEW_RAW 2 - -void -srv_mysql_thread_release(void); -/*==========================*/ -os_event_t -srv_mysql_thread_event_get(void); -void -srv_mysql_thread_slot_free( -/*==========================*/ - os_event_t event); /************************************************************************* Boots Innobase server. */ |